Portable Gas Detection for On-the-Go Safety

Ensuring safety in dynamic environments requires reliable gas detection. Stationary detectors can be cumbersome and hinder movement, making them unsuitable for situations demanding on-the-go monitoring. That's why portable gas detectors have become. These compact devices provide real-time alerts of hazardous gases, permitting workers to respond quickly and efficiently.

Integrating with advanced sensor technology, portable gas detectors can detect a wide range of harmful substances, including methane, carbon monoxide, hydrogen sulfide, and a multitude of additional gasses. Some models even offer data logging, providing valuable insights for post-event analysis and process improvement.

In industries like construction, manufacturing, oil and gas, and emergency response, portable gas detection plays a crucial role in protecting workers from unforeseen hazards.

Hazardous Environments Require Fixed Gas Detection

Ensuring the safety of personnel and preserving assets in hazardous environments demands a robust approach to identifying potential gas leaks. Stationary gas detection systems provide continuous safeguards by proactively assessing the air for toxic gases. These systems frequently utilize a network of sensors strategically positioned throughout the premises. Upon detecting a gas above a preset threshold, the system instantly alerts required response measures, such as alarm notifications, exhaust adjustments, and even automatic cessation.

  • Advantages of Fixed Gas Detection include:
  • Continuous monitoring for potential hazards
  • Early detection of issues
  • Elevated well-being of personnel
  • Safeguarding of equipment and assets
  • Compliance with industry best practices

Thorough Online Gas Monitoring Systems: Real-Time Data Insights

Modern industrial settings rely heavily on precise gas monitoring to ensure worker safety and environmental compliance. Sophisticated online gas monitoring systems provide real-time data monitoring, enabling prompt intervention in case of hazardous conditions. These networks typically utilize a network of detectors to proactively monitor various gas concentrations within designated areas. The obtained data is then transmitted to a central console for real-time visualization and evaluation. This facilitates informed decision-making, allowing for effective management of gas levels and reduction of potential risks.

Detector Alert: Smart Alarm Management

A gas leak can pose a serious threat to your safety. That's why it's crucial to have a reliable platform in place for early detection and alerting. Smart alarms offer an advanced solution, providing real-time detection and immediate alerts in case of a potential leak. These intelligent devices utilize sensors to identify the presence of harmful gases like methane or carbon monoxide, and they can be linked with your smartphone or home automation system for seamless control.

When a leak is detected, the smart alarm will activate an immediate alert, notifying you through audible tones and visual lights. Some advanced models even allow for wireless shutoff of gas supply, minimizing the risk and providing an extra layer of security. By implementing a smart alarm system, you can take proactive measures to ensure your residence is safe from gas leaks, offering peace of mind and preventing potential hazards.

Ensuring Workplace Safety: Integrating Gas Detectors and Control Systems

In numerous industrial settings, the existence of harmful gases can pose a significant threat to worker well-being. To mitigate these risks, integrating gas detectors and control systems has become essential. Gas detectors continuously monitor the air for the presence of hazardous gases, providing instantaneous notifications when harmful levels are detected. These technologies can be integrated with control systems to immediately deactivate equipment or ventilation networks, minimizing potential harm. Implementing such a comprehensive approach ensures a safer working environment for all employees.
